Cette page explique comment résoudre les problèmes liés au service Backup and DR pour les ressources sauvegardées dans le coffre de sauvegarde à l'aide du plan de sauvegarde. Pour trouver des solutions pour les ressources protégées à l'aide du modèle de sauvegarde dans la console de gestion de l'appliance, consultez ID d'événement et messages d'erreur.
Problème PERMISSION_DENIED
Le job de sauvegarde a échoué en raison d'autorisations manquantes dans le projet source. Le message d'erreur suivant s'affiche :
Backup and DR agent or backup vault service agent is missing the permissions required to take backups of resources in the source project.
Pour identifier le problème, procédez comme suit :
- Si le coffre de sauvegarde et la ressource se trouvent dans le même projet,
attribuez le rôle IAM Agent Backup and DR (
roles/backupdr.serviceAgent) à l' agent de service Backup and DR, qui se présente au formatservice-<project-number>@gcp-sa-backupdr.iam.gserviceaccount.com. - Si le coffre de sauvegarde et la ressource à protéger se trouvent dans des projets différents, attribuez le rôle IAM Administrateur d'instances Compute (v1) (
roles/compute.instanceAdmin.v1) à l' agent de service Backup and DR, qui se présente au formatservice-<project-number>@gcp-sa-backupdr.iam.gserviceaccount.com.
Problème FAILED_PRECONDITION
Le job de sauvegarde a échoué lorsque la ressource protégée a été supprimée. Le message d'erreur suivant s'affiche :
Backup job failed due to unmet conditions. Check for source resource deletion or backup misconfigurations.
Pour résoudre ce problème, procédez comme suit :
Vérifiez que la ressource protégée existe toujours sur la page Instances de VM.
Si la suppression était intentionnelle, supprimez la protection de l'instance Compute Engine.
Erreur 412 : la contrainte constraints/compute.storageResourceUseRestrictions a été enfreinte
L'erreur 412 se produit lorsqu'une tentative de sauvegarde d'un Persistent Disk ou d'un Google Cloud Hyperdisk
échoue en raison d'une violation de contrainte de règle d'administration lors de la création de la sauvegarde.
Un message d'erreur s'affiche alors :
Error 412: Constraint constraints/compute.storageResourceUseRestrictions violated for project aaaaa. projects/aaax/zones/aa-aaaaa-a/disks/aaaa can't be used within your project., conditionNotMet
Backup and DR crée des sauvegardes de vos Persistent Disks et de vos Google Cloud Hyperdisks. Les sauvegardes se trouvent dans votre Google Cloud projet (également appelé projet locataire) géré par Google Cloud. Le projet locataire existe dans l'organisation google.com, distincte de la vôtre.
Votre règle d'administration détermine où vous pouvez créer des ressources de stockage.
L'erreur The Constraint constraints/compute.storageResourceUseRestrictions violated signifie qu'une ressource ou une sauvegarde enfreint la règle en étant créée dans un projet locataire qui ne fait pas partie de la structure organisationnelle autorisée.
Comme le projet locataire se trouve dans l'organisation google.com, il ne respecte pas la règle que vous avez définie, ce qui entraîne l'échec de la sauvegarde.
Pour résoudre cette erreur, suivez ces instructions :
Recherchez la règle d'administration qui implémente la contrainte
constraints/compute.storageResourceUseRestrictions. Pour en savoir plus sur l'affichage des règles d'administration à l'aide de la Google Cloud console, consultez Afficher les règles d'administration.Modifiez la règle
constraints/compute.storageResourceUseRestrictionspour inclure le dossier de projet locatairefolders/238813353932utilisé par Backup and DR dans sa liste d'autorisation.Enregistrez les modifications apportées à la règle après avoir ajouté le dossier à la liste d'autorisation.
Testez à nouveau l'opération de sauvegarde une fois que la règle d'administration est mise à jour et propagée, ce qui prend généralement quelques minutes. La sauvegarde doit se poursuivre sans enfreindre les restrictions d'utilisation des ressources de stockage. Si l'opération échoue toujours, contactez le service Cloud Customer Care pour obtenir de l'aide.